windows_and_doors_that_are_energy_efficient.webp### 1) Energy-efficient windows and doors One of the easiest and most cost-effective ways to improve your home's energy efficiency is by upgrading your windows and doors. High-quality, energy-efficient windows and doors help to reduce heat loss in the winter and keep your home cooler in the summer.

2) Solar panels

Solar panels are an excellent investment for homeowners looking to reduce their reliance on fossil fuels and lower their energy bills. By installing solar panels on your roof or in your backyard, you can generate clean, renewable energy to power your home.

3) Green roofing

Green roofs, also known as living roofs, are an innovative way to insulate your home while reducing stormwater runoff and creating a habitat for local flora and fauna. These roofs are covered with plants, which help to absorb rainwater, provide insulation, and improve air quality.

4) Energy-efficient appliances, fixtures, and materials

Upgrading your appliances and fixtures to energy-efficient models is a simple way to save energy and reduce your home's environmental impact. Look for Energy Star-rated appliances and low-flow fixtures that conserve water, and consider installing a smart thermostat to optimize your home's heating and cooling system. 5) Insulation and sealing

Proper insulation and sealing can significantly reduce your home's energy consumption and increase its overall comfort. By insulating your walls, attic, and basement, and sealing any gaps or cracks, you can prevent drafts and maintain a consistent temperature throughout your home.
